SAFETY DATA
This is a SAFETY ALERT SYMBOL.
When you see this symbol on the product, or in the
manual, look for one of the following signal words and be
alert to the potential for personal injury, death or major
property damage
Warns of hazards that WILL cause serious personal
injury, death or major property damage.
Warns of hazards that CAN cause serious personal
injury, death or major property damage.
Warns of hazards that CAN cause personal injury
or property damage.
NOTICE:
Indicates special instructions which are very
important and must be followed.
NOTICE:
Blackmer Power Pumps MUST only be installed in
systems, which have been designed by qualified
engineering personnel. The system MUST conform to all
applicable local and national regulations and safety
standards.
This manual is intended to assist in the installation and
operation of Blackmer Power pumps, and MUST be kept
with the pump.
Pump service shall be performed by qualified technicians
ONLY. Service shall conform to all applicable local and
national regulations and safety standards.
Thoroughly review this manual, all instructions and
hazard warnings, BEFORE performing any work on the
pump.
Maintain ALL system and pump operation and hazard
warning decals.
